EDUCATION DEPARTMENT
.VACANCIES TEMPORARILY FILLED. (Per United Press Association.) WELLINGTON, Auckland 21. The Education Department lias effected a saving of about £I2OO a year in tbo salaries of members of the clerical division through the arrangements made by tlie Minister for carrying on tlie work of officers who have joined the Expeditionary Forces. The Department has lost temporarily seventeen of its officers in connection with the war. Their positions are being kept open for them and temporary clerks employed in the meantime. _______________
